Pups lick wounds of snared Hyena in Kruger National Park

This video showing a hyena with a snare around its neck was taken in Kruger National Park recently. Although the hyena was able to break the snare free, it is still attached around its neck where it is cutting into the skin. Video by Gert de Koker.
